Position Summary
The Dispatch, Logistics & Cross-Border Permits Coordinator is responsible for coordinating the daily movement of freight and fleet assets while ensuring compliance with transportation, safety, and regulatory requirements. This role serves as the primary link between drivers, customers, brokers, and internal operations, ensuring shipments are dispatched efficiently, delivered on time, and supported with the required permits and documentation.
Key Responsibilities
Dispatch & Logistics Coordination
- Schedule and dispatch trucks, trailers, and drivers for daily operations.
- Assign and optimize loads based on equipment availability, delivery schedules, and driver Hours of Service (HOS).
- Monitor fleet activity using GPS and dispatch software.
- Track shipments in real time and provide updates to customers and stakeholders.
- Plan efficient routes while considering weather, road conditions, border crossings, and delivery requirements.
- Coordinate long-haul, short-haul, cross-border, reefer, flat deck, step deck, heavy haul, and specialized equipment movements.
Cross-Border Compliance & Permitting
- Coordinate freight movements between Canada and the United States.
- Prepare and verify customs and shipping documentation.
- Work closely with customs brokers, customers, and drivers to facilitate smooth border crossings.
- Obtain and manage oversize, overweight, specialized transport, fuel, and trip permits.
- Ensure permits and regulatory requirements are in place before equipment is dispatched.
- Maintain company registrations, licensing, and operating authorities as required.
Driver & Customer Support
- Serve as the primary point of contact for drivers during transit.
- Provide direction and support for delays, route changes, breakdowns, weather events, and other operational challenges.
- Communicate professionally with customers regarding shipment status and service updates.
- Build and maintain positive relationships with drivers, customers, brokers, and third-party carriers.
Compliance & Administration
- Ensure compliance with applicable transportation regulations, including HOS, NSC, TDG, FMCSA, and Transport Canada requirements.
- Maintain accurate records of shipments, permits, mileage, fuel usage, and operational documentation.
- Process Bills of Lading, rate confirmations, customs documents, dispatch records, and other transportation paperwork.
- Enter and maintain data within Transportation Management Systems (TMS).
- Support billing, payroll, and reporting functions through accurate recordkeeping.
